On average across the year,
yes, Guinea-Bissau is hotter than
San Jose, California
.
Guinea-Bissau has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and San Jose, California has an average temperature of 16°C/61°F.
Guinea-Bissau's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 39°C/102°F, which is hotter than San Jose, California's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 27°C/81°F).
On average across the year, no, Guinea-Bissau is not colder than San Jose, California . Guinea-Bissau has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F and San Jose,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Guinea-Bissau has more rain than
San Jose, California. Guinea-Bissau has an average annual rainfall of 1175mm and San Jose, California has an average annual rainfall of 317mm.
Guinea-Bissau's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 443mm, which is wetter than San Jose,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 63mm).
